Recently came back to this game. Turns out it is really great - maybe because I'm older ?wiser. I have the four disk version. I installed the game, then the patch, then the Fix pack by Platter and then the restoration pack. Everything went swimmingly until I tried to use the dodecahedron. Got the dodecahedron open - went to "click for more" and the game froze. Tried prior save games with same result. Two questions: 1. Does anyone know how to fix this? 2. Will not being able to open the dodecahedron keep me from completing the game?

I've tried both install orders and both worked for me, so I'm not sure this is the problem. The packs should be fairly compatible, as most of the Restoration fixes were taken straight from the Fixpack anyway (it says "bug fixed by Platter" if you look into the detailed log).

The dodecahedron is important, it contains information about something an earlier incarnation left for himself. You need to find this in order to find Ravel and progress in the game.

Many thanks to all who replied to this thread. I finally got the dodecahedron to unfold and have met Ravel. Retrospectively I probably created the problem. I did not realise that the uninstall failed to remove mods and patches. Once a realised this I went back and deleted everything, reinstalled the game , patches, fix pack, and restoration pack. then put in a saved game and it worked perfectly.
